MathJax resources as a Jupyter Server Extension.
Install from PyPI:
> pip install jupyter_server_mathjax
This will automatically enable the extension in Jupyter Server.
To test the installation, you can run Jupyter Server and visit the /static/jupyter_server_mathjax/MathJax.js
endpoint:
> jupyter server
To install an editable install locally for development, first clone the repository locally, then run:
`pip install -e .[test]`
Note that the editable install will not install the data file that automatically configures the extension for use. To manually enable it, run:
jupyter server extension enable --py jupyter_server_mathjax
To build for distribution, use the build
package:
pip install build
python -m build
Then release using twine:
twine check dist/*
twine check dist/*